Dargezin-Vorwerk
Dargezin-Vorwerk is a hamlet in Gützkow, Vorpommern-Greifswald, Mecklenburg-Western Pomerania. Dargezin-Vorwerk is situated nearby to the hamlet Kölzin Ausbau, as well as near Sanz Hof 3.Photo: Chron-Paul, CC BY-SA 4.0.
- Type: Hamlet
- Description: human settlement in Germany
- Also known as: “Dargezin Vorwerk” and “Dargezin-Meierei”

Kölzin is a village and a former municipality in the Vorpommern-Greifswald district, in Mecklenburg-Vorpommern, Germany. Since 25 May 2014, it is part of the town Gützkow.
